> >The RT limits were neatly marked in gold, shaded black, lettering on the
> >bulkhead to the left of the entrance to the lower deck, something like 24
> >lower, 33 upper and a maximum of 5 standing, anyone remember the exact
> >figures?
>
> You called?
>
> Seating capacity 56 passengers
> 26 lower deck
> 30 upper deck
>
> For the sake of completeness, the RTL and RTW were the same; the RLH was
> 26/27, the RM 28/36, the RML 32/40, the RMC 27/30 and the RCL 31/34
>
> As for standing passengers:
> (*)
> "5 standing passengers are allowed on this vehicle unless seats are
> available at the following times".
>
> (the actual times varied over the years; this is from my schooldays
> which I remember far more clearly than what happened yesterday)
>
> "Monday to Friday:
> Midnight to 9.30am.
> 4.00pm to 7.00 pm
> 10.00pm to midnight
>
> Saturday
> Midnight to 9.30am
> 12 noon to 2.00pm
> 10.00pm to midnight
>
> Sunday
> 10.00pm to midnight"
